The above page was created using a 15″ KNK Maxx and KNK Software. The page title “Spring” was made with 1 Bean Sprout DNA font and cut 5-times, then layered to create a dimensional title.
The polygon shape tool was used to create multiple hexagons and then manipulate them to scale. This same method was used to create a hexagon template in order to trim 4×6 photos into this shape. Once the sizing was determined the contour object tool (.10) to create an outline for card stock photo-mats for the patterned hexagons and photos. The circle shape tool was used to create nine 1″ circles that I folded over twine to for my page banner. Two 5-petal flowers were made with the star shape tool and rounding mechanism. The flowers were crinkled and inked with a pre-made flower and button center. Lastly, I embellished my page with bling, text (font used: Agnes), pre-made flowers and a happy banner.
This same method recently to cut 475 hexagons for a layout class I taught earlier this week. This endeavor would have been overwhelming without my KNK Maxx!
I keep my 15″ KNK Maxx settings at Overcut 15 & Trailing Blade 20 because I only use my machine to cut paper.
